WebProcedure to find . When the heavenly body is on the upper meridian the latitude by meridian passage . 1. Find the declination of the body; 2. Find the true altitude of the body and name it North or South, according to the bearing from the observer; 3. Subtract true altitude from 90˚ to obtain the zenith distance, and name it opposite from the ...

Web13 apr. 2014 · In astronomy, the observer’s coordinate system for observing a star (or the Sun or Moon) involves two coordinates, azimuth and altitude.
